      What is Personal Development?
      Personal development is the process of improving oneself in all areas of life, including physical, mental, emotional, and spiritual aspects. It can involve setting and achieving goals, developing new skills and knowledge, improving one's health and well-being, and building positive relationships. Personal development can be a lifelong process, or it can be something you undertake for a specific period of time, such as when you're working towards a personal goal.

      What can I do with a degree in Personal Development?
      There are many different things you can do with a degree in personal development. Some people choose to use their skills and knowledge to help others improve their lives, while others may further their own personal growth and development. There are also many career options available for those with a background in personal development, such as working as a life coach, personal development consultant, or in a human resources role.

      What degrees can I earn in Personal Development?
      Personal development degrees are designed to help students improve themselves in all areas of life. The curriculum typically includes coursework in psychology, sociology, and other behavioral sciences. Students also delve into training in goal setting, time management, and other personal development skills.
